Abstract

The article presents approaches to the formation of algorithmic thinking, as the most important component of the intellectual development of engineering personnel in the conditions of digital development of Russia. These approaches are related to the implementation of STEAM education, as well as ideological standards of CDIO engineering training. Solved the following problems: selected methods of evaluation of algorithmic thinking in adolescents; designed practical tasks for teaching course on robotics in the environment of Lego Mindstorms Education EV3; implemented training course in the school curriculum of adolescents; carried out diagnostics of algorithmic thinking in students before the course and after the event; analyzes information gained in the course of. An experimental study based on the developed evaluation methodology confirms that the implementation of these approaches allows to effectively form the algorithmic thinking of future engineers, starting from adolescence, by introducing robotics classes in the Lego Mindstorms Education EV3 environment into the school curriculum.
